Transaction 950e706801aff1afeb66bfbf47269611d76e267807d1ccc0572f2e7cb3c98e2c

2 Input
1 Outputs
  • 950e706801aff1afeb66bfbf47269611d76e267807d1ccc0572f2e7cb3c98e2c:0
  • value  3691123
    address  3DvLyf4yjxGAfKWwXMvsbctGo6pngjrcxi